Abstract
In this paper an overview of analytical solutions to the Grad-Shafranov equation for the tokamak equilibrium is given as is a short derivation of the governing equation. First, a solution to the homogeneous equation is presented. Subsequently, three analytical solutions corresponding to three different source functions are defined. Finally, some illustrative examples are given.
